September 26th sees the maybe most unbelievable collaboration in music history: Scooter team up with UK rock legends Status Quo to release their version of "Jump That Rock (Whatever You Want)" - and this one is a real blast! But that's not all, because one week later, on October 3rd, there will be the release of an extended version of the album "Jumping All Over The World".
This extended version, called "Jumping All Over The World - Whatever You Want" will be released in three different set-ups. The standard version includes all tracks from "Jumping All Over The World" plus seven "Hands On Scooter" bonus tracks. These tracks are reinterpret Scooter songs performed by well known artists such as the Bloodhound Gang. There will also be a second disc with the greatest Scooter tracks of all time, the new single together with Status Quo and another bonus track.
The premium version offers, next to the two CDs from the standard version, a DVD with Scooter "Live From Berlin", recorded on August 1st 2008. The third set-up, called deluxe edition, is a must-have for all fans and will only be sold at selected stores. Next to the two CDs and the live DVD there will be another DVD with all previous music videos, a limited fan t-shirt and a signed autograph card.
